Superflux Beginnings East Vancouver’s Superflux Beer Company burst onto the craft beer scene somewhat mysteriously in 2015, then known as Machine Ales. From contract brewing at Callister Brewing and then Strathcona Beer Company, Superflux has now secured their reputation and a permanent home on Clark Drive near East Hastings Street. Superflux Ethos President and co-founder Adam Henderson explains that he and co- founder Matt Kohlen have emphasized cool designs and fun names to set their beers apart: “Matt designed many of our initial labels, and his aesthetic set the tone for what many people expect from us. It’s a mix of slowly gathered inspiration, stream of consciousness and luck.” Love for the local brand Superflux remains strong, whether for the classic IPAs that helped put the brewery on the map or for their newer canned explorations.
